Alexander Dubček

Born: November 27, 1921
Died: November 7, 1992 (aged 70)
Bio: Alexander Dubček was a Slovak politician and, briefly, leader of Czechoslovakia. He attempted to reform the communist regime during the Prague Spring but he was forced to resign following the Warsaw Pact invasion of Czechoslovakia.
